不可否认,想要成为一名 的程序员确实是需要掌握多种编程语言。通过这几年的自虐式学习,我也慢慢的掌握了这些编程语言,*知道这过程多么痛苦,介绍七款让我又爱又恨的编程语言!
写这篇文章的原因:
1.给新人学习编程语言的一些建议。
2.因为它们确实,能让我们赚更多的钱。(我就是那么俗!)
3.我要吐槽他们!!!!!!(我真的非常严肃….)
(申明:大家可以当娱乐看一下,对一些细节也希望大家不要过于较真!)
1.C语言
难度系数:5星吐槽系数:4星推荐指数:4星
C语言给我的感觉,就是一位神秘莫测而又高冷型的女生形象。这是因为c语言相比其他编程语言难度高一些,这也就多了一丝神秘,每当我以为我快要接近它时,它又狠心的将我推开!狠心的C!语!言!
我无法拒绝C语言的原因:UNIX由C编写而成,其运行在大部分手机与大多数云环境当中,这意味着必须有人继续使用星号与大括号进行开发,否则这一切都将无法为继。另外,还有设备驱动程序、嵌入式程序以及Linux/Unix代码库的维护工作——好了,这个忧伤的话题到此结束。
我!要!开!始!吐!槽!
作为拥有“便携式汇编语言”头衔的C语言, 充斥着各种问题!相信没有人会喜欢编写,大量独立的头文件,也更没有几个人能在使用预处理器的时候保持平和心态。
从理论上讲,我们应该能够利用指针的数学能力,完成无比睿智的壮举,但很少有人能超越已经存在的数据结构。事实上,鼓捣指针往往正是代码崩溃的起点。即使大家自身水平能够轻松搞定指针,但也需要编写冗长的注释加以记录,这相当让人抓狂。另外,我想问一下各位,有人几个人能记住编写C代码所应当遵循的全部 实践吗?例如避免一切潜在的安全漏洞,好吧,我个人不太行。
2.JavaScript
难度系数:4星吐槽系数:4星推荐指数:4星
JavaScript给我的感觉,就是一位悲观型的女生形象。为什么这样说呢,谁叫它们总是用小括号、中括号与大括号包裹着自己呢!
我无法拒绝JavaScript的原因:互联网以及无数浏览器仍然坚持使用JavaScript,而Node.js的出现甚至迫使我们在服务器端也要使用JavaScript。至少在可预见的未来,JavaScript还将不断折磨我们。
自己是从事五年的全栈工程师,不少人私下问我,年前端该怎么学啊,方法有没有?
没错,年初我花了一个多月的时间整理出来的学习资料,希望能帮助那些想学习前端,却又不知道怎么开始学习的童鞋。
点击:加入
开!始!吐!槽!
JavaScript的 们希望打造一款现代化语言。遗憾的是,他们的成果逼迫我们不断使用小括号、中括号与大括号来完成正确的嵌套关系。而匿名函数、闭包与JSON数据结构则让我们的小指变得越来越发达。
另外,我们还需要北京中科白癜风医院平安医院北京看白癜风病 的医院